What you'll do

  • Own end-to-end root cause failure analysis investigations on microelectronics: failing in manufacturing, test, and field, from initial failure characterization through final corrective action verification

  • Conduct advanced electrical fault isolation and characterization using curve: trace, TDR, RF characterization, Lock-in Thermography, OBIRCH, EBIRCH, EBAC, nanoprobing, and related techniques to precisely localize defects in complex devices

  • Perform advanced physical failure analysis using SEM, FIB, EDS, SAM,: cross-sectioning, and related techniques to identify failure mechanisms in silicon, packaging, and interconnects

  • Apply physics-of-failure principles and deep knowledge of semiconductor: failure modes (electromigration, thermal fatigue, delamination, EOS/ESD, solder joint fatigue, etc.) to determine root causes

  • Drive corrective actions by working directly with silicon design, packaging,: and manufacturing teams to implement and validate design or process changes based on FA findings

  • Author detailed technical reports documenting failure modes, root cause: conclusions, supporting data, and corrective action effectiveness
